The Aeron Solution

Aeron is an innovative blockchain-based platform that is set to improve aviation safety. Utilizing blockchain technology, Aeron tackles some of the most common industry problems in pilot training and flight school management, such as, flight log forgery, aircraft flight hours underreporting,  stopping any sort of modification or distortion of logged data and replacing an outdated system with new technologies and sophisticated tools.

This innovative system will significantly reduce the risk of fatal accidents, while leaving all data transparent and easily traceable.

Aeron, Blockchain Data Repository

The Aeron application, once fully deployed, will flag any discrepancies between the Aeron data sources: a pilot, an aircraft  operator, and Air Traffic Control (ATC) data where available; the app will further enable aviation authorities to detect any issues that may have risen.

The application will also keep an up-to-date record for pilots licenses, flagging expired licenses or pending renewals.

The application will be a part of the entire ecosystem for general aviation and flight schools; pilots are able to log flight hours and submit their records. Common users can gain access to the curated database of aviation services through Aerotrips.com.

Flight schools and training institutions will have the significant improvement in process automation.
